Using Datalog Engine to Fix LLM Memory Inconsistency
petrusenko_max · x · 2026-08-29
To address LLMs losing track of changed assumptions during long sessions, Jordy Zomer utilized program analysis and a Datalog engine. This approach automatically maintains knowledge states and prevents invalid conclusions based on outdated premises.
